Skip to content
Snippets Groups Projects
Commit fa5a381f authored by Andreas Schindlbeck's avatar Andreas Schindlbeck
Browse files

Kalender: Gesamte Serie löschbar

parent 1435641d
No related branches found
No related tags found
No related merge requests found
...@@ -162,6 +162,18 @@ ...@@ -162,6 +162,18 @@
</entityParameter> </entityParameter>
</children> </children>
</entityConsumer> </entityConsumer>
<entityActionGroup>
<name>seriesActionGroup</name>
<children>
<entityActionField>
<name>deleteSeries</name>
<title>Delete</title>
<onActionProcess>%aditoprj%/entity/Appointment_entity/entityfields/seriesactiongroup/children/deleteseries/onActionProcess.js</onActionProcess>
<iconId>VAADIN:TRASH</iconId>
<tooltip>series delete action</tooltip>
</entityActionField>
</children>
</entityActionGroup>
</entityFields> </entityFields>
<recordContainers> <recordContainers>
<jDitoRecordContainer> <jDitoRecordContainer>
......
import("system.vars");
import("system.calendars");
import("system.question");
import("system.translate");
var event = JSON.parse(vars.getString("$param.MasterEntry_param"));
if(event != undefined && event != "")
{
var reallyDelete = question.askYesNo(translate.text("Do you really want to delete this recurring appointment?"), "", false);
if(reallyDelete)
calendars.removeEntryByUID(-1, null, event[calendars.ID], null);
}
\ No newline at end of file
...@@ -3669,6 +3669,9 @@ ...@@ -3669,6 +3669,9 @@
<entry> <entry>
<key>Assignment</key> <key>Assignment</key>
</entry> </entry>
<entry>
<key>Complaint</key>
</entry>
</keyValueMap> </keyValueMap>
<font name="Dialog" style="0" size="11" /> <font name="Dialog" style="0" size="11" />
<sqlModels> <sqlModels>
......
...@@ -22,6 +22,10 @@ ...@@ -22,6 +22,10 @@
<key>Notifications</key> <key>Notifications</key>
<value>Benachrichtigungen</value> <value>Benachrichtigungen</value>
</entry> </entry>
<entry>
<key>Do you really want to delete this recurring appointment?</key>
<value>Wollen Sie wirklich die Serie löschen?</value>
</entry>
<entry> <entry>
<key>Add to Campaign</key> <key>Add to Campaign</key>
<value>Zu Kampagne hinzufügen</value> <value>Zu Kampagne hinzufügen</value>
......
...@@ -3718,6 +3718,9 @@ ...@@ -3718,6 +3718,9 @@
<entry> <entry>
<key>Assignment</key> <key>Assignment</key>
</entry> </entry>
<entry>
<key>Complaint</key>
</entry>
</keyValueMap> </keyValueMap>
<font name="Dialog" style="0" size="11" /> <font name="Dialog" style="0" size="11" />
</language> </language>
...@@ -25,6 +25,7 @@ ...@@ -25,6 +25,7 @@
<organizerField>ORGANIZER</organizerField> <organizerField>ORGANIZER</organizerField>
<categoriesField>CATEGORIES</categoriesField> <categoriesField>CATEGORIES</categoriesField>
<favoriteActionGroup1>PartStatActionGroup</favoriteActionGroup1> <favoriteActionGroup1>PartStatActionGroup</favoriteActionGroup1>
<favoriteActionGroup2>seriesActionGroup</favoriteActionGroup2>
<entityField>#ENTITY</entityField> <entityField>#ENTITY</entityField>
</appointmentPreviewViewTemplate> </appointmentPreviewViewTemplate>
<neonViewReference> <neonViewReference>
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ment